Lower light in Headlight
Hello,
I've got a 2018 ZL1 1LE and the light below the main headlight stopped working. I've drawn around it in yellow in the attached photo. I think this is considered the DRL (Daytime Running Light) on the ZL1 1LE but I'm not sure. I know other model cars have a light below this too. It would seem that it's part of the headlight assembly which is horribly expensive so I want to make sure I check all the simple stuff first. Does anyone know if this light has a corresponding fuse? I checked F31 and F36, they don't affect it. I pulled F32 and F36 to see if I could make it stop working on the drivers side but while I can make the main headlight stop by pulling those, I can't seem to find the one which controls this lower light. I'd like to check find the fuse that controls it and, if the it really is the light and not just a fuse, I wonder if a possible "fix" is to just disable the driver side too so at least the car won't look funky. It's 90% track car so I have no real issue flipping on the main headlights all the time, it just looks funky with it sort of winking at you. Hope it's an easy fix because if not, it's major surgery... Thanks for any input you folks have. |

As per the service manual, its fuse is F18 (body control module 4, see below), I'd check that first. Hope it was just a fuse and not the headlight assembly itself, because that's pretty expensive indeed.

IIRC, the headlight assembly has a ballast for the HID light and then there’s another module plugged into the DRL board, maybe try replacing that

You guys are always so spot on! F18 and F28 do seem to control them. However, it didn't help me. I swapped them and had no change. The drivers side continued to work and the passenger side did not. I've not checked out that "module" yet, though I may want to do that before going down the road of new headlight.
What about pulling F18 and F28 - do you guys think there would be any negative to doing that? Or would it just simply disable the DRL on both sides? Odd "fix" but it may be just what I need. Please let me know and thanks for the excellent posts so far guys! Thank you, |

Following up on Bumbleboy92's suggestion, I strongly suspect it's either that module or the ballast for the LED DRL strip built into the headlight, components #9 and #10 on that diagram. Both are easy to replace, the ballast is bolted to the back of the headlight assembly, and the module is seated somewhere underneath, I'm not sure exactly where, since my car is an SS.

Just exchange the module from left to right and you will know if the module is the issue.
As well try to measure the output from PIN 8 if there is power .. as this would be the power for this DRL. |

The LED and HID ballast on these cars are known to fail randomly and very early often with zero warning. That is more than likely your culprit in this case!
